₹25 Crore for Vaccine Production to Haffkine – Deputy Chief Minister Ajit Pawar

Deputy CM Pawar directs Maharashtra Medical Goods Procurement Authority to purchase 1.5 lakh snakebite vaccines from Haffkine

Haffkine Empowerment: Three-member committee for implementation of Dr. Mashelkar Committee’s recommendations

Mumbai, Sept 2025 : Haffkine Institute has made a valuable contribution in the field of vaccine production, and has played a major role in eradicating polio from the country. The Government of India has a demand for 268 million oral polio vaccines. To manufacture these vaccines, a fund of ₹25 crore from the two percent cess of the Haffkine Procurement Cell will be given to Haffkine Bio-Pharmaceutical Corporation. This proposal was given in-principle approval at a meeting chaired by Deputy Chief Minister Ajit Pawar.

The meeting regarding issues of Haffkine Bio-Pharmaceutical Corporation and pensions of retired employees and officers of the institution was held in the committee room at Mantralaya under the chairmanship of Deputy CM Ajit Pawar.

To empower Haffkine Institute and Haffkine Bio-Pharmaceutical Corporation, a committee was earlier set up under the chairmanship of Dr. Raghunath Mashelkar. The report of this committee has been submitted to the government. For effective implementation of the recommendations of this committee, a new committee should be constituted, comprising secretaries of the Medical Education, Public Health, and Planning Departments. The Deputy CM also directed that this committee should prepare a five-year roadmap for the empowerment of Haffkine.

At present, Haffkine has 1.5 lakh vaccines for snakebite ready. The anti-snakebite vaccine prepared by Haffkine is effective and reliable. Deputy CM Pawar further directed that these vaccines should be procured by the Maharashtra Medical Goods Procurement Authority through Haffkine.
